About the role

  • Under the supervision of a Professional Services Director or Sr.
  • This role ensures that customer implementations are completed on time, within budget, and with high customer satisfaction.
  • In addition to team leadership and project oversight, this role requires strong technical acumen, particularly in data preparation, workflow documentation, and product configuration.

Responsibilities

  • Lead, coach, and mentor a team of Implementation Analysts and/or Implementation Consultants, fostering strong team culture, accountability, and continuous development.
  • Drive execution of high-quality customer implementations by overseeing data requirements gathering, technical platform configuration, and administrator training.
  • Support team members in troubleshooting technical issues related to data formatting, system logic, and configuration workflows.
  • Provide hands-on support for complex projects, including advising on data transformation strategies and workflow optimization.
  • Understand customer pain points and partner with cross-functional teams to simplify, enhance and automate existing processes that will improve customer workflow.
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with Sales, Product, Engineering, and Customer Success to align customer expectations and streamline delivery.
  • Identify and mitigate risks across the portfolio, proactively escalating issues and developing resolution strategies.
  • Support recruiting, onboarding, and training initiatives to scale the implementation team in alignment with business needs.

Requirements

  • 3 years of project delivery experience in a SaaS setting.
  • Ability to learn domain, products, and project delivery effectively.
  • Strong analytical thinking, systems perspective, and the ability to understand and model customer workflows.
  • Strong track record of motivating self and teams toward excellence.
  • Demonstrated ability to balance profitability with customer-service mindset.
  • ETL tools, ETL report creation, macros and visual basic are not required, but highly desirable.
  • Experience with government budgeting concepts, finance/budgeting solutions, procurement, permitting, licensing, asset management or other related fields is advantageous.
  • Ability to travel approximately 25% of the time

Nice to have

  • Bachelor's degree preferred or commensurate experience demonstrating the ability to perform the above responsibilities
  • Prior experience in a people management role is highly desirable.
  • Geographic Information Systems (GIS) software experience strongly preferred

Compensation

  • Chicago, IL: $110,000 - $125,000
  • On target ranges above include base plus a portion of variable compensation that is earned based on company and individual performance.
  • The final compensation will be determined by a number of factors such as qualifications, expertise, and the candidate's geographical location.
